...I just recieved an amazing cd from a band called The Frogs. Apparently unsung heroes in the states for underground music, to hear them is to believe them. The Frogs are two brothers from Milwaukee who sing about evrything from priests to car crashes with some of the most insane lyrics I've ever heard...all this with these swwet cool guitar riffs over the top of it all , sounding alot like Bolan, and early Bowie, Adam and the Ants...it's hard to tell what they are going to do one track to the next, but I promise you you'll be singing along with tears of laughter streaming down your face. Some of their biggest fans are people within the industry, like Beck and Smashing Pumpkins and Eddie Veder. I received ny cd thruogh a friend but I think you can look it up on the internet..Have Fun, this is an incredible find!!...

..."An album with only 7 tracks?" I hear you scream. When you've heard it you'll be screaming "Aw, I was enjoying that, I wish there was more.." This is a lovely mix of six new and one previously released track (timewatching- though here it is sung live) which is beautifully put together and wonderfully sung by Neil Hannon and backed by a 30 piece orchestra.
The first track, "in Pursuit of happiness" was so good it was pinched by Tomorrows world as their theme tune. Not the first time one of their tracks has been pinched (eh Father Ted fans??!!) and is very dramatic musically whilst the lyrics are very honest and truthful about being in love.
"Everybody knows" is a very tear-jerking soft tune that is very romantic. (I should know, it made my fiancee cry when I taped it for her when we were first going out!!) about being besotted...
